Block

#21,980,089
Block Number
21,980,089 @ 06/19/2025, 10:49:40
Status
Finalized
ID
0x014f63b969d6ed54716b51a53141573e07e861bec077b5c670f9fd4e193ec59f
Transactions
Gas Used
4749654/40000000 (11.87% Used)
Total Score
2,146,702,410 (+97)
Rewards
18.40 VTHO